An ionic bond is a chemical bond between two atoms in which one atom seems to donate its electron to another atom.

So, to check if a bond between two elements is ionic or not we have to look for the electronegativities of them. Depending on the difference between the electronegativities of the two atoms the bond can be ionic or covalent.
